PURPOSE: A sensorless solar tracking method for monitoring and cooling a sunlight panel and a sunlight panel assembly used in the same are provided to improve cooling efficiency by a hole for the flow of air and to monitor each panel. CONSTITUTION: A sensorless solar tracking method for monitoring and cooling a sunlight panel comprises following steps. User parameters are set up and stored(S1). Each voltage(V1~V9)(or current) of 9 panels of a solar energy panel assembly is read(S2). Whether the sum total of each voltage of the 9 panels of the solar energy panel assembly is higher than panel minimum power(VOMIN) is determined(S3). If the sum total of each voltage of the 9 panels of the solar energy panel assembly is higher than panel minimum power, the operation of each panel is checked(S4). Whether the value of(V1+V4+V7)-(V3+V6+V9) is within right and left allowable voltage difference(VLR) is determined(S5). Whether the value of(V1+V4+V7)-(V3+V6+V9) is within top and bottom allowable voltage difference(VUD) is determined(S6). The performance of each panel is checked(S7). |
